At the core of the pressure diaphragm capsule is a flexible diaphragm, typically made from materials such as stainless steel, silicone, or other elastomers. This diaphragm reacts to changes in pressure by deflecting, which creates a differential movement that can be measured and translated into a precise reading. The design of the diaphragm is crucial, as it must withstand various pressure ranges while maintaining sensitivity and durability over time.
Manufacturing these diaphragm elements involves sophisticated techniques to ensure quality and precision. Factories dedicated to the production of pressure diaphragm capsule elements typically utilize methods such as stamping, drawing, and laser cutting to shape the diaphragm components. Advanced quality control measures are implemented throughout the manufacturing process to ensure that each element meets rigorous standards. This commitment to quality is essential, especially in applications where accuracy is vital, such as in the aerospace, automotive, and medical industries.
In the automotive industry, for instance, pressure diaphragm capsule elements are used in fuel systems and tire pressure monitoring systems. These applications demand high reliability and immediate response to pressure changes, which these elements provide. In the medical field, these components help in monitoring patients' vital signs, where precision is life-critical.
Moreover, pressure diaphragm capsule elements are vital in the oil and gas industry, where they are employed in various instruments to monitor pipeline pressures and ensure safety. The ability to withstand harsh environments and fluctuating pressures makes these elements indispensable in maintaining operational integrity.
